400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么excel文件很大但是内容很少

作者:路由通
|
398人看过
发布时间:2026-04-17 13:46:58
标签:
在日常工作中,许多用户都曾遇到一个令人困惑的现象:一个微软Excel(Microsoft Excel)表格文件,其文件体积异常庞大,但实际打开后却发现其中包含的有效数据或工作表内容却非常稀少。这种“虚胖”的情况不仅影响文件传输与存储效率,还会显著降低表格程序的运行速度。本文将深入剖析导致这一问题的十二个核心原因,从文件格式、对象残留、格式设置到公式与缓存等多个维度,提供详尽的分析与权威的解决方案,帮助您从根本上为表格文件“瘦身”,提升工作效率。
为什么excel文件很大但是内容很少

       作为一款功能强大的电子表格软件,微软Excel(Microsoft Excel)无疑是现代办公中不可或缺的工具。然而,许多资深用户,甚至包括一些数据分析师,都曾被一个看似矛盾的问题所困扰:为何一个表格文件的体积动辄几十兆甚至上百兆,但实际浏览时,却发现其中只有寥寥几行或几列数据,内容显得空空如也?这种“体积与内容不成正比”的现象,不仅占用宝贵的磁盘空间,更会在通过电子邮件发送、使用网盘同步或在性能较低的电脑上打开时,带来令人沮丧的延迟与卡顿。今天,我们就来抽丝剥茧,深入探讨导致Excel文件异常庞大的十二个常见根源,并提供经过验证的解决策略。

       文件格式的历史遗留与选择差异

       首先,我们需要理解Excel文件格式的演进。旧版的“Excel 97-2003工作簿”(.xls格式)与现在主流的“Excel工作簿”(.xlsx格式)在底层结构上有天壤之别。前者采用二进制复合文件格式,将所有信息打包在一个文件中,结构相对紧凑但扩展性有限。而后者,即.xlsx格式,本质上是一个遵循开放打包约定标准的压缩包,它内部由一系列可扩展标记语言文件构成,分别存储工作表数据、格式、公式等。通常,同样的内容保存为.xlsx格式会比.xls格式体积小。但如果您收到一个古老的.xls文件,它可能因为历史原因包含了冗余的二进制信息,导致体积庞大。解决方案是,在确认兼容性后,使用“另存为”功能,将其转换为.xlsx格式,这通常能立即实现显著的“瘦身”效果。

       隐藏行列与未使用的单元格区域

       一个容易被忽视的“体积杀手”是表格中存在的、远超实际数据范围的“已使用区域”。即便您只在A1到C10单元格输入了数据,Excel有时也会将“已使用区域”的边界错误地扩展到很远,比如至XFD1048576(即最后一列和最后一行)。这可能是因为您曾经在那些遥远的单元格中输入过内容后又删除,或者进行过全选、设置格式等操作。表格程序在保存文件时,会记录这个被认定的“已使用区域”,从而导致文件无谓增大。您可以按下“Ctrl + End”组合键,查看光标跳转到的位置,如果它远离您的实际数据区,就证实了这一点。修复方法是:删除那些多余的行和列(选中行号或列标右键删除),然后保存文件。

       格式设置的滥用与蔓延

       单元格格式(如字体、颜色、边框、数字格式)本身也会占用文件空间。当您对整行、整列甚至整个工作表应用了格式(例如设置了背景色或边框),这些格式信息会被记录在文件中。即使那些单元格是空的,格式信息依然存在。更常见的情况是,复制粘贴数据时,连带大量的格式信息一同粘贴,使得格式蔓延到整个“已使用区域”。请有意识地使用“选择性粘贴”中的“数值”或“公式”选项,避免引入无关格式。定期检查并清除无用区域的格式:选中这些区域,点击“开始”选项卡中的“清除”按钮,选择“清除格式”。

       对象与图形元素的无声堆积

       图表、形状、图片、文本框、控件等嵌入对象是增大文件体积的常见元凶。有时,这些对象可能因为设置为白色或与背景同色而“隐形”,或者被其他对象完全覆盖,导致用户无法直接察觉它们的存在。此外,从网页或其他文档中复制内容时,可能会无意中带入大量微小的、不可见的图形对象。要查找它们,您可以打开“开始”选项卡,点击“查找和选择”,然后选择“选择对象”。此时,鼠标指针会变成箭头,您可以在工作表上拖拽一个矩形框,所有被框选到的对象都会被选中并显示控制点,之后可以将其删除。

       复杂公式与易失性函数的拖累

       公式,尤其是数组公式和引用大量单元格的复杂公式,会显著增加计算负担和文件大小。更需警惕的是“易失性函数”,例如“现在”、“今天”、“随机数”、“间接”、“偏移量”等。这些函数的特点是:每当表格发生任何计算(包括打开文件、编辑单元格),它们都会强制重新计算自身以及所有依赖于它们的公式,这种频繁的计算活动会被记录在文件中,间接导致体积膨胀。应审慎使用这类函数,并考虑是否可以用静态值或非易失性函数替代部分计算。

       数据透视表的缓存与后台存储

       数据透视表是强大的数据分析工具,但它会为源数据创建一个独立的缓存副本。即使您删除了透视表本身,这个缓存数据有时仍会残留在文件中。当源数据量很大时,这个缓存会占据可观的空间。如果您的工作簿中包含多个基于同一源数据的数据透视表,默认情况下它们会共享缓存,这有助于控制体积。但若创建时选择了“新建数据透视表缓存”,则会生成独立的副本,从而增加文件大小。在不需要时,彻底删除数据透视表并保存文件,是释放空间的有效方法。

       名称管理器中的冗余定义

       名称管理器允许您为单元格区域、常量或公式定义易于理解的名称。然而,随着表格的不断修改,可能会积累大量已经不再被任何公式引用的“僵尸”名称。这些无效的名称定义并不会被自动清理,它们会一直保留在文件中,占用少量但积少成多的空间。您可以通过“公式”选项卡下的“名称管理器”打开对话框,逐一检查每个名称的“引用位置”和“范围”,删除那些无用的名称。

       条件格式规则的过度应用

       与普通单元格格式类似,条件格式规则如果被应用到了过大的范围(如整列),每个单元格的规则判断逻辑都需要被存储。当规则复杂或数量众多时,这也会成为文件体积的负担。请检查您的条件格式规则(“开始”->“条件格式”->“管理规则”),确保应用范围精确到实际需要的数据区域,而不是整张工作表,并及时删除不再需要的规则。

       工作表与工作簿的“幽灵”残留

       有时,您可能已经删除了某个工作表中的所有内容,但这个工作表本身仍然存在于工作簿中。同样,工作簿中可能隐藏着一些完全空白或几乎无用的工作表。每一个工作表的存在,即使为空,也会在文件中占据一定的结构开销。此外,从其他工作簿复制工作表时,可能会带入一些您不需要的、隐藏的特定数据或样式。定期检查工作表标签,删除那些完全无用的工作表,可以有效减小文件。

       外部链接与查询的未断连接

       如果您的表格文件曾经链接到其他外部工作簿、数据库或网络资源,即使这些链接已经失效或不再需要,相关的连接信息(如路径、查询定义)可能仍然保存在文件中。这不仅增加体积,还可能在打开文件时引发烦人的更新提示。您可以通过“数据”选项卡下的“查询和连接”窗格,或者“编辑链接”对话框(旧版路径)来检查和断开这些不再需要的外部链接。

       撤销历史与临时信息的驻留

       为了支持强大的撤销功能,表格程序会在编辑过程中保留大量的操作历史信息。在极其复杂或长时间的编辑会话后,这部分信息可能会变得相当庞大。虽然通常会在保存时得到清理,但在某些异常情况下(如程序非正常关闭),部分信息可能会残留。一个简单的解决方法是:关闭当前文件(不保存),然后重新打开它。或者,将内容复制粘贴到一个全新的工作簿中。

       嵌入字体的额外开销

       为了保证文件在不同电脑上显示效果一致,Excel允许您将特定的字体文件嵌入到工作簿中。这项功能虽然贴心,但代价是巨大的——中文字体文件尤其庞大,动辄数兆甚至十几兆。嵌入字体会直接导致文件体积成倍增长。除非有严格的排版一致性要求,否则应避免使用此功能。您可以在“文件”->“选项”->“保存”中,查看并取消“将字体嵌入文件”的选项。

       宏代码模块的存储影响

       对于启用了宏的工作簿(.xlsm格式),其中包含的Visual Basic for Applications代码模块也会占用空间。如果代码中包含了大量的注释、未使用的函数或从其他项目导入的冗杂代码,也会不必要地增大文件。定期优化和清理宏代码是保持此类文件精简的好习惯。

       版本保留与共享工作簿特性

       Excel的“版本”功能(允许保存同一文件的多个版本)以及已过时但偶尔仍会遇到的“共享工作簿”功能,都会在文件中保存额外的历史变更信息,以便多人协作或追溯修改。如果不再需要这些历史记录,应关闭这些功能。对于共享工作簿,需要先停止共享,然后保存文件,才能清除相关数据。

       单元格注释与批注的积累

       大量的单元格注释(或称批注),特别是其中包含富文本格式或较长文本时,也会增加文件大小。如果许多注释已经过时或无意义,批量删除它们可以释放空间。您可以通过“开始”->“查找和选择”->“选择窗格”来辅助管理对象,但批注通常需要逐个工作表进行审查和清理。

       打印机与页面设置信息

       每个工作表都可能存储了独立的页面设置信息,如页眉页脚、打印区域、缩放比例等。当工作表数量众多时,这些信息累积起来也不可小觑。虽然这部分通常占比较小,但在追求极致优化的场景下,统一并简化页面设置也有助于文件的精简。

       综合诊断与终极“瘦身”方案

       面对一个庞大的文件,我们可以采取一套系统性的诊断和清理流程。首先,使用“Ctrl + End”定位虚假的已使用区域并清理。其次,利用“选择对象”功能查找并删除隐藏的图形。接着,逐一检查名称管理器、条件格式、外部链接和数据透视表缓存。然后,审视公式的复杂度和函数使用。最后,考虑将最终数据复制粘贴至一个全新的工作簿中,这能有效剥离绝大多数不可见的残留信息。如果文件允许,将其保存为二进制的“Excel工作簿”格式通常是最优选择。

       总而言之,Excel文件“虚胖”是一个多因素导致的结果,它就像房间角落中悄然堆积的杂物,虽不显眼,却实实在在地影响着空间与效率。通过理解上述十二个核心原因并采取相应的清理措施,您将能够有效掌控文件的体积,让您的表格运行如飞,管理起来也更加得心应手。希望这份深度剖析能成为您处理此类问题时的实用指南。


相关文章
流水灯什么效果
流水灯作为一种经典的动态灯光效果,通过多个光源按预设顺序依次点亮与熄灭,营造出如水流般连续流动的视觉感受。它不仅广泛应用于建筑装饰、景观照明和广告展示,更在电子技术领域成为入门教学与实践的重要载体。本文将深入剖析流水灯的工作原理、设计类型、控制方式及其在各行业中的具体应用效果,并结合权威技术资料,系统阐述其技术实现与艺术表现的融合价值。
2026-04-17 13:45:46
41人看过
移动软件有哪些
移动软件已成为现代数字生活的核心,其种类繁多,功能各异。本文将系统性地探讨移动软件的主要类型,涵盖从基础通讯到专业工具的各个领域,旨在为用户提供一个清晰、全面且具有深度的分类指南,帮助大家更好地理解和利用手机中的应用程序世界。
2026-04-17 13:45:46
289人看过
什么能沉金
黄金因其独特的化学性质,具有极高的密度和稳定性,但自然界中仍有少数物质能在特定条件下“沉”于黄金之下。本文将深入探讨比黄金密度更高的贵金属、合金及特殊材料,解析其物理特性、应用场景与市场价值,并澄清“沉金”概念背后的科学原理与常见误区,为读者提供一份权威、详尽的专业指南。
2026-04-17 13:45:39
76人看过
cirudsc是什么
本文将为您深入解析“cirudsc是什么”这一主题。我们首先会从最基础的术语定义入手,厘清其核心概念,随后追溯其产生的技术背景与发展脉络。文章将系统阐述其工作原理与核心架构,分析其主要功能、技术特性及应用场景,并与相关技术进行对比以明确其定位。最后,我们将探讨其面临的挑战、未来发展趋势以及它为用户和行业带来的实际价值,为您提供一个全面、专业且实用的认知框架。
2026-04-17 13:45:36
207人看过
为什么excel单元格显示al
当您在微软电子表格软件中输入数据时,单元格偶尔会显示“al”字样,这通常不是简单的拼写错误。这种现象背后涉及软件的核心逻辑,包括引用样式、自动更正、宏代码影响、格式设置以及潜在的软件故障。本文将深入剖析“al”出现的十二种常见原因及其背后的机制,并提供一系列行之有效的排查与解决方案,帮助您彻底理解并解决这一问题,提升数据处理效率。
2026-04-17 13:45:23
125人看过
word为什么图片插不进去
当您在微软Word文档中尝试插入图片却屡遭失败时,这通常并非单一原因所致,而是涉及文件格式兼容性、软件设置冲突、系统资源限制乃至文档自身保护状态等一系列复杂因素的共同作用。本文将深入剖析导致图片插入失败的十八个核心成因,并提供经过验证的详细解决方案,帮助您从根本上解决问题,恢复文档编辑的流畅体验。
2026-04-17 13:45:07
200人看过